树莓派4b怎么连接can控制器
时间: 2024-05-07 18:21:33 浏览: 213
利用 CAN232B 转换器组建 CAN 控制网络
连接 CAN 控制器需要以下步骤:
1. 确保树莓派的操作系统已经安装了 CAN 控制器驱动,可以使用以下命令检查:
```
sudo modprobe can
sudo modprobe can-raw
sudo modprobe can-dev
```
2. 将 CAN 控制器插入树莓派的 GPIO 引脚上。
3. 通过 SPI 总线连接 CAN 控制器和树莓派,具体连接方式可以参考 CAN 控制器的硬件文档。
4. 配置 CAN 控制器的参数,例如波特率等。
5. 启动 CAN 接口,可以使用以下命令:
```
sudo ip link set can0 up type can bitrate 500000
```
其中 can0 表示使用的 CAN 接口,bitrate 表示波特率。
6. 使用 CAN 工具进行测试,例如 candump 工具可以查看 CAN 总线上的消息:
```
candump can0
```
这样就可以连接 CAN 控制器了。需要注意的是,具体的连接方式和配置参数可能因为不同的 CAN 控制器而有所不同,需要参考相关的硬件文档进行配置。
阅读全文